NEWPORT NEWS, Va. (AP) - Three people have been injured in a shooting in Virginia.

WAVY-TV (https://bit.ly/1EMz0bb) reports Newport News police officers responded to calls after witnesses heard about 30 shots Monday night.

Police say they found two men and a woman with gunshot wounds. A 38-year-old Suffolk man and a 26-year-old Newport News woman suffered gunshot wounds to the head. A 36-year-old Newport News man had a gunshot wound to his hand.

All three were taken to the hospital but police say none of their injuries appear to be life-threatening.

Police have no information about the shooter.

This is the same area where two people were shot at an apartment complex April 6 and another double shooting left one man dead April 19.
